身份证编码的含义
身份证编码的含义
身份证编码的含义
目前,中国居民身份证的代码是18位,其含义为:
1. 前1、2位数字表示:所在省份的代码;
2. 第3、4位数字表示:所在城市的代码;
3. 第5、6位数字表示:所在区县的代码;
4. 第7~14位数字表示:出生年、月、日(月、日不是两位数的,前面加0补足,如01~09);
5. 第15、16位数字表示:所在地的派出所的代码;
6. 第17位数字表示性别:奇数表示男性,偶数表示女性;
7. 第18位数字是校检码,根据前面十七位数字码,按照ISO 7064:1983.MOD 11-2校验码计算出来的检验码。
计算方法为:
1.将身份证号码的前17位数分别乘以不同的系数(从第一位到第十七位的系数分别为:7、9、10、5、8 、4、2、1 、6 、3 、7、9 、10、5 、8 、4、2) 。
2.将17位数字和系数相乘的结果相加。
3.用加出来的和除以11,看余数是多少?
4.余数只可能有0、1、2、3、4、5、6、7、8、9、10这11个数字,分别对应身份证的最后一位号码为1、0、X、9、8、7、6、5、4、3、 2。
例如:如果余数是2,则身份证的第18位数字是Ⅹ;如果余数是10,身份证的最后一位数字就是2。(有性趣的,可以验证一下自己的身份证最后一位,看对不对)
数字的含义

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。